Title: Philip Dean Winters: A Trailblazer in Lighting Innovations

Introduction: Philip Dean Winters, based in Senoia, GA, is an accomplished inventor with an impressive portfolio of 36 patents. His work primarily focuses on innovative lighting solutions that combine functionality with advanced technology. Winters has made significant contributions to the field through his inventive designs and engineering prowess.

Latest Patents: Among his recent innovations, two patents stand out. The first is a **Configurable Lighting System**, which describes a luminaire featuring a housing that forms a cavity. This system includes an aperture that crosses the outer surface of the housing and a substrate installed within the cavity. An electrical connector is positioned adjacent to the aperture, paired with a dial that allows users to select discrete correlated color temperatures (CCT) from multiple light sources. The second notable patent is a **Self-Contained Junction Box**. This lighting structure incorporates a junction box that contains a cavity and a mounting plate with both inner and perimeter sections. Notably, the design enables routing electrical wires effectively from the junction box to the light source, enhancing both safety and ease of installation.
